Unit Definitions

What is Kibibit ?

A Kibibit (Kib or Kibit) is a binary unit of digital information that is equal to 1024 bits. It is defined by the International Electro technical Commission(IEC) and is used to measure the amount of digital data. The prefix 'kibi' is derived from the binary number system, it is used to distinguish it from the decimal-based 'kilobit' (Kb) and it is widely used in the field of computing as it more accurately represents the amount of data storage and data transfer in computer systems.

What is Terabit ?

A Terabit (Tb or Tbit) is a decimal unit of measurement for digital information transfer rate. It is equal to 1,000,000,000,000 (one trillion) bits. It is commonly used to measure the speed of data transfer over computer networks, such as internet connection speeds.
